Polish Central Bank Holds Rates Again as Economy Accelerates
Governor Adam Glapinski has said that there was little room left for rate cuts.
Source: Narodowy Bank PolskiPoland’s central bank said inflation could fall further in the coming quarters before stabilizing around policymakers’ target — adding to signals that its pause in interest rate cuts will be short-lived.
The Monetary Policy Council left the benchmark steady at 4% for a second month on Wednesday, matching the forecast of a majority of analysts. The 10-member panel cut its main rate by a total of 175 basis points last year as inflation proved softer than anticipated.
